Open Roberta és un simulador de Lego Mindstorm. Serveix per crear programes en un entorn de programació molt semblant a l'Scratch.
Visualitzeu el següent vídeo per entendre els principis bàsics de programació de Open Roberta:
Ara que ja saps com funciona el programa, utilitza el simulador Open Roberta per resoldre els següents reptes. Un cop resolt cada repte, penja una petit vídeo / captura de pantalla del programa que has fet al teu Sites amb la seva execució.
1. Desplaçar-se fins al color vermell, aturar-se 2 segons i girar-se
2. Desplaçar-se fins al color groc, aturar-se 2 segons i girar-se
3. Desplaçar-se fins al color verd, aturar-se 2 segons i girar-se
4. Desplaçar-se fins al color blau, aturar-se 2 segons i girar-se
5. Repetir els passos 1-4 (il·limitadament)
Utilitza els sensors de colors per resoldre la pràctica.
Programar un robot que es desplaci des de la base verda fins a algun dels 2 punts situats sobre la línia semicircular.
Requeriment: el robot s'ha de moure sempre per sobre la línia negra i ha de passar, forçosament, per la diagonal de la zona quadrangular. Com que al centre de la zona hi ha un obstacle, l'haurà de sortejar i seguir el seu camí.
Ajuda: podeu programar les instruccions del robot a partir del sensor d'ultrasons (distàncies) del robot respecte a les parets o l'obstacle del tauler. Us resultarà més fàcil si activeu la vista de dades dels sensors mentre feu la programació.